#443d3a h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#443d3a is composed of 26.7% red, 23.9%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.3% magenta, 14.7%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 18 degrees, a saturation of 7.9% and a lightness of 24.7%. #443d3a color hex could be obtained by blending #887a74 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#443d3a color description : Very dark grayish orange.
The hexadecimal color #443d3a has RGB values of R:68, G:61,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.15,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4472122.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040404 is the darkest color, while #faf9f9 is the lightest one.
